Domino 9 und frühere Versionen > Entwicklung

Problem mit Evaluate und @Name

<< < (2/4) > >>

koehlerbv:
Wie immer: Gern geschehen, Driri.

Bernhard

Axel:
Hi,

es geht auch einfacher:

...
formel = {@Name([CN]; CreatedBy)}
user = Evaluate(formel, doc)
...

Der Bezug zum Dokument wird über den zweiten Parameter von Evalute hergestellt.


Axel

koehlerbv:
Du hast natürlich vollkommen Recht, Axel. Mein Blick war immer noch zu kurz (und die Gedanken eigentlich bei einem ganz anderen Problem). Weiter, als zu "irgendwie kommt mir das jetzt komisch vor" hat es gestern nicht gereicht ...

Danke,
Bernhard

Driri:
Macht ja nix, funktioniert ja in beiden Fällen.

Aber da hätte ich noch mal eine Frage zu :

Gibt es einen Unterschied zwischen der Verwendung von {} und | als Abgrenzung ?
Ich hatte die Formel erst so wie von Bernhard aufgemalt im Script, allerdings mit |. Ich dachte bisher immer, daß man die genauso verwenden kann, ist dem nicht so ? Weil mit den Pipes hatte ich immer die Fehlermeldung.

koehlerbv:
Der Unterschied zwischen geschweiften Klammern und Pipes besteht eigentlich nur darin, dass mit den Pipes auch Zeilenumbrüche in den String mit aufgenommen werden - ansonsten ist es egal, welche Zeichen man verwendet.

Bernhard

Navigation

[0] Themen-Index

[#] Nächste Seite

[*] Vorherige Sete

Zur normalen Ansicht wechseln